CQRMEM
|
CQRMEM - Response Mode Error Mask\n
CQE is able to automatically detect errors in response.
The S/W defines which bits of the response need to be checked. All bits set to 1 (written by S/W) are analyzed.
The CQE reports Response Error Detected Interrupt (CQREDI) when N bit of CQRMEM is 1 and N bit of response is 1.
Response for SEND_QUEUE_STATUS (CMD13) automatically sent by CQE is ignored.
